Run-D.M.C. was the first rap group to
achieve mainstream success. The three
members, Run (Joseph Simmons),
D.M.C. (Darryl McDaniels), and Jam
Master Jay (Jason Mizell), all grew up in a
middle-class neighborhood in the New
York City borough of Queens. Run and
D.M.C. met while rapping at a local club
for teenagers. They stayed in touch while
attending different colleges and later
asked another friend, deejay Jam Master
Jay, to join their act. Their first single, “It’s
Like That,” was released in 1983, and they
had several more hits in the 1980s. Run’s
brother, Russell Simmons, is a famous rap
music producer.
